“The number and proportion of multi-generation households have been increasing in Australia over the last quarter of a century so that almost one in five Australians now live in a household that comprises two or more generations of related adults. Multi-generation households are particularly common in our major cities. In Sydney, where the practice is most common, almost one-quarter of all households comprised multiple generations.”
– February 2012, AHURI Final Report No. 181, Australian Housing and Urban Research Institute
